Blinds over 2400 width are considered oversized and may have slight wavering to the fabric along the pockets. This is considered normal for sewn pocket blinds and not considered a manufacturing fault. To avoid this we recommend ordering multiple smaller blinds.
Restriction on Mounting – Face or Architrave Mount only
We do not recommend Roman Blinds to go into a recess mount (inside the frame) and only to be mounted as a face fit or architrave fit. There are many reasons for this and we make sure to comply with the Australian Soft Furnishing industry guidelines for Roman Blind manufacturing.
Any Roman blinds purchased with the intention of a recess mount will not be covered by our 5 year warranty.
The three main reasons are as follows;
- Roman Blind fabric is known to take time to settle and will eventually make the blind too long for the inside mount. It is impossible to judge the allowance as the variable to the cloth, size and weight of the blind will differ. Achieving the desired 5mm gap at the base of the blind cannot be obtained.
- The cording is behind the blind and to operate you must push the canvas aside to get to them. This will result in damaging the fabric by being crushed and soiled. Operating the blind will eventually burn through the blockout coating due to having to drag the cords diagonally across the rear of the fabric to raise and lower the blind.
- It is rare for a window to be perfectly square and often is out by a few mm’s. This will give the appearance of the blind being crooked and the gap down the side of the blind will aggregate from a few mm’s at the top to a considerable gap to the bottom edge.
Projection of headboard
This is the timber headrail size and the distance the cloth will come out from the window. Wider headboards are only recommended for when you are having another product behind the Roman Blind eg; Lace curtain or Roller Blind
Standard 40mm’s
70mm, 90mm, 120mm
Operation
Standard Cord & Cleat tie off
Heavy Duty Cord Lock (additional)
Chain Drive (additional)
Cord locks - A simple self locking device. They do have restrictions and are not recommended on blinds that are too small or too large.
Small blinds - as the weight in the blind is not sufficient to release and lower the blind properly.
Large blinds - due to the amount of cords going into the locking device, loosing traction and will not hold into position.
We only recommend on blinds between the sizes of 1200 -2400 width and will not guarantee on blinds outside these sizes.
Chain Drives - A continous looped chain reducing operating effort. Highly recommended for large blinds to make operating easier and to keep the blind level.
Placing on smaller width windows under 900mm's, is generally not recommend due to slowness of operation.
Batten Spaces & Blinds Lining Up
Batten spaces are determined by the drop measurement of the blind and different drops will have different panel sizes.
If you have different drops in the same room and would like to have the same panel sizes so the blinds line up visually, you are able to select this option in the Design & Order area. We will then alter the base panels to suit.
Be aware that this may cause risk of fading, due to a smaller batten space becoming necessary at the base panel of the blind.
Fabrics
Select from our large range of Light Filtering & Blockout Fabrics.
We only use Mildew Protected cloths. Please see individual fabrics for composition details.
Blockout Fabrics will stop light coming through the cloth, however some light may still be noticeable through the stitch holes on the blind and will not achieve 100% light control.
Cleaning
General dusting or vacuuming is suitable and should be done regularly.
For spot cleaning, wash with warm soapy water.
Do Not Scrub as you may damage the coating of the fabric.
Make sure to rinse clean with water.
Allow the blind to completely dry before rolling up.
We also recommend Chux magic erasers for spot cleaning.
